Iboostweb · Newsroom

iBoost Web: Elevating Your Online Presence With Expert Web Design in Atlanta
iBoost Web, a leading web design agency in Atlanta, is proud to announce its comprehensive range of web design services aimed at helping businesses establish a strong and impactful online presence.

March 23, 2024